1. We tell you exactly what to bring and where it goes, before the truck shows up

Before you pack a single box, we walk through your current furniture piece by piece. We measure your new home, space plan each room, and map out your layout in advance. That means you'll know in advance whether your sectional works in the new living room, whether that extra dresser earns its spot, and what's worth buying new instead of moving at all.

This is the step that saves the most time and money in a move. Guessing leads to a truck full of furniture that doesn't fit and a garage full of things you'll never use again. A real floor plan, built before move day, eliminates that.
